Bare act text — BNSS 5
5. Saving.—Nothing contained in this Sanhita shall, in the absence of a s pecific provision to the contrary, affect any special or local law for the time being in force, or any special jurisdiction or power conferred, or any special form of procedure prescribed, by any other law for the time being in force. 19 CHAPTER II CONSTITUTION OF CRIMINAL COURTS AND OFFICES

What is CrPC 5 equivalent in BNSS?
CrPC Section 5 (Saving) corresponds to Section 5 of the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ita, 2023 (BNSS).
What changed between CrPC 5 and BNSS 5?
No change.
